Transaction 63ae06d9b5e5993011607b6fcae357c976000bc1b3ca8e79b42fb300a490e876
2 Input
2 Outputs
- 63ae06d9b5e5993011607b6fcae357c976000bc1b3ca8e79b42fb300a490e876:0
- 63ae06d9b5e5993011607b6fcae357c976000bc1b3ca8e79b42fb300a490e876:1
value 28248390
address 1P5wgXbjXixpEh8YrkDoSRYKdCbazuYjV7
value 206795184
address 1Nb6gNk1Ng18xsV3cP92NuWvSVAoR2K9TM